H5开发工程师如何解决开发过程中的难题?
在当今数字化时代,H5开发工程师在网页设计和开发领域扮演着至关重要的角色。然而,随着技术的不断进步和用户需求的日益复杂,H5开发过程中也面临着诸多难题。本文将深入探讨H5开发工程师如何解决开发过程中的难题,以期为同行提供有益的借鉴。
一、了解H5技术特点与优势
首先,H5开发工程师需要充分了解H5技术特点与优势。H5作为一种跨平台、兼容性强的技术,具有以下特点:
- 跨平台性:H5可以在各种浏览器和移动设备上运行,无需针对不同平台进行开发。
- 兼容性强:H5支持多种浏览器和设备,能够满足不同用户的需求。
- 易于传播:H5页面可以通过社交媒体、邮件等方式快速传播。
了解H5技术特点与优势有助于工程师在开发过程中更好地应对各种难题。
二、优化性能,提升用户体验
H5开发工程师在解决开发难题时,应始终关注性能优化和用户体验。以下是一些优化策略:
- 合理使用CSS3和JavaScript:合理使用CSS3和JavaScript可以提升页面加载速度和渲染效率。
- 图片优化:对图片进行压缩和优化,减少页面加载时间。
- 缓存机制:合理运用缓存机制,提高页面访问速度。
三、解决兼容性问题
H5开发过程中,兼容性问题是一个常见的难题。以下是一些解决策略:
- 使用polyfill:polyfill可以帮助弥补不同浏览器之间的兼容性问题。
- 测试与调试:在开发过程中,进行充分的测试与调试,确保页面在不同浏览器和设备上都能正常运行。
四、应对复杂布局
H5开发工程师在处理复杂布局时,可以采用以下方法:
- 使用Flexbox和Grid布局:Flexbox和Grid布局可以轻松实现复杂布局。
- 响应式设计:采用响应式设计,确保页面在不同设备上都能保持良好的显示效果。
五、案例分析
以下是一个H5开发过程中的案例分析:
案例:某企业希望开发一款用于宣传活动的H5页面,要求页面具有以下特点:
- 美观大方:页面设计要符合企业品牌形象。
- 功能丰富:页面包含图片、视频、动画等多种元素。
- 兼容性强:页面需在不同浏览器和设备上正常运行。
解决方案:
- 设计阶段:采用专业的UI设计工具,确保页面美观大方。
- 开发阶段:使用H5技术,结合CSS3、JavaScript等前端技术,实现页面功能。
- 兼容性测试:在开发过程中,进行充分的兼容性测试,确保页面在不同浏览器和设备上都能正常运行。
六、总结
H5开发工程师在解决开发过程中的难题时,需要充分了解H5技术特点与优势,关注性能优化和用户体验,应对兼容性问题,处理复杂布局。通过不断学习和实践,H5开发工程师可以提升自身技能,为用户提供更好的服务。
猜你喜欢:专属猎头的交易平台